Shortlist Revealed For 2026 BRITs Critics' Choice Award

Thursday, 04 December 2025 Written by Jon Stickler

The artists nominated for the 2026 BRITs Critics' Choice award have been revealed.

Jacob Alon, Rose Gray and Sienna Spiro have made the final shortlist for the prize, which spotlights rising British acts tipped for commercial success. The winner will be announced in January.

Previous winners include Adele, Sam Smith, Florence + The Machine, The Last Dinner Party, and Myles Smith, who won this year.

The award, previously named the BRITs Rising Star between 2020 and 2025, returns to its original Critics' Choice title for 2026. Eligible artists must not have had a top 20 album or more than one top 20 single on the Official UK charts as of October 31, 2025. Stacey Tang, chair of the 2026 BRIT Awards committee and co-president of RCA Records at Sony Music UK, said:

"How exciting to spotlight a new wave of UK musicians shaping popular culture. Awards and recognition for emerging artists is now more important than ever, and Critics’ Choice has long championed brilliantly talented new artists. 

"This cohort shares the same early spark displayed by previous winners like Adele, Florence + The Machine, Sam Fender, Myles Smith and Emeli Sande. This year’s finalists are a great reminder that commercial momentum grows from creative ambition and artistic bravery."

The BRIT Awards ceremony will relocate to Manchester's Co-Op Live arena on February 28, marking the first time the event will be held outside of London in its 48-year history. It will also be broadcast exclusively on ITV1, ITVX, STV and STV Player, with more details about the event to be revealed in due course. 

This year's BRIT Awards were dominated by Charli XCX, who won five, including Best Artist, Best Album, and Song of the Year. Check out a full list of winners here.
